Electronics Engineer job role
Electronics engineers are involved in the design, development, and testing of electronic systems. From concept to implementation, you will be responsible for ensuring that electronic components and systems meet the required specifications. You may also be involved in troubleshooting, maintaining, and enhancing existing electronic systems.
Electronics engineer responsibilities
As an electronics engineer, your responsibilities may include, but are not limited to:
- Designing and developing electronic circuits and systems
- Conducting feasibility studies and project assessments
- Collaborating with cross-functional teams on product development
- Testing and troubleshooting electronic systems for performance and functionality
- Analysing and interpreting technical data and specifications
- Ensuring compliance with industry standards and regulatory requirements
- Providing technical support and guidance to project teams
Electronics engineer qualifications
To become an electronics engineer, you will typically need a bachelor's degree in Electrical Engineering, Electronics Engineering, or a related field. Further specialisation in a particular area, such as telecommunications or embedded systems, may be advantageous. Some of the common qualifications for an electronics engineer include:
- Bachelor's degree in Electrical Engineering, Electronics Engineering, or a related field
- Knowledge of circuit design, digital signal processing, and microelectronics
- Familiarity with relevant software and programming languages
- Understanding of electronic manufacturing processes and quality control
- Familiarity with regulatory and safety standards in the electronics industry
Electronics engineer skills
As an electronics engineer, you will need a range of technical and non-technical skills to excel in your role. Here are some key skills that are essential for electronics engineers:
- Strong analytical and problem-solving abilities
- Proficiency in computer-aided design (CAD) software for circuit design
- Knowledge of programming languages, such as C or Python
- Excellent communication and teamwork skills
- Attention to detail and ability to work with precision
- Up-to-date knowledge of industry trends and advancements
- Ability to adapt to changing technologies and learn new skills
